Fancy winning some actual breath that used to belong to Inside No 9 star Steve Pemberton? Then you need to get yourself over to eBay.

That’s where the actor and former League Of Gentlemen star is currently auctioning off a balloon he previously blew up – with all proceeds going to Sport Relief.

The purple balloon – described on the site as ‘possibly a bit deflated’ – appeared in the final episode of Inside No 9, as part of a storyline in which a balloon containing the breath of a musician was auctioned off.

The highest bidder will also receive a poster for the episode, Last Gasp, signed by Pemberton and cohort Reece Shearsmith.

And it appears to be a popular draw, having so far attracted 20 bids – the highest so far offering £69 for the coveted item.

Proceeds from the auction will go to the Sport Relief charity Give It Up, founded by Russell Brand to offer support to those recovering from drug and alcohol addiction.

Inside No 9, which finished its run on BBC Two on February 26, will return for a second series after proving popular with viewers and critics.

Shearsmith recently broke the news via Twitter, telling his followers: ‘Did I mention we already have a second series? I don’t think I did. Oh well – we do. Something to do innit.’
